ROME – A few hours after the official announcement of Carlo Conti as the next artistic director and host of Sanremo 2025-2026, Codacons has launched an appeal to the presenter to stop the singer selection criteria followed by Amadeus for the last five years. “We ask Conti to break with the past and move away as much as possible from the path traced by Amadeus”, explains Codacons. “Music must be brought back to the center of the event, because in recent years the choices that have affected the Festival have gone in the sole direction of guaranteeing the broadcast a very young audience and the attention of social networks >, to the full detriment of the quality of the songs in competition”.

“In this sense we ask Carlo Conti to establish a specific technical commission for the choice of songs for the next festivals, which takes into account the real value of the songs and the artists who perform them, and not the number of followers on social media or the views on the web guaranteed by the singers, nor their temporary notoriety linked to participation in singing talent shows”, writes the association. “Finally, considering the serious problems on the televoting and hidden advertising front that have affected the last Festivals, Codacons asks Conti to provide for the participation of a representative of consumer associations in all phases of Sanremo, to guarantee transparency towards the public”.
